WASHINGTON (TNND) — President Donald Trump said he would like Rep. Marjorie Taylor Greene to resume her political career at some point, on Saturday. This statement comes despite the recent fallout between them.
Trump’s comment also comes a day after Greene announced that she would resign from her office in January.
In a brief phone interview with NBC News, Trump said, “It’s not going to be easy for her” to return to politics, though he added, “I’d love to see that.”
Trump added, “She’s got to take a little rest.”
In recent weeks, Greene has become more vocal about the differences between her thoughts on his policies and priorities. Greene noted that Trump was devoting what Greene believed to be excessive time and attention to foreign leaders, rather than to the concerns of everyday Americans.
She has also been a strong advocate for releasing the Epstein files, which Trump has opposed several times.
Trump has lashed out at Greene over the change in her attitude towards him, even calling her a “traitor.”
